NATIONAL law firm, Gateley has boosted its Manchester corporate recovery team with three new hires.
Partner Richard Healey associate Vicki Bates and solicitor Danielle Haston, have joined from the Manchester office of Howes Percival.
Mr Healey has significant expertise in recovering the proceeds of fraud on behalf of victims with a particular specialism in pursuing those culpable for tax evasion, having been principal external legal advisor to HMRC’s Specialist Investigations Directorate for eight years. He recently advised HMRC on all aspects arising from the administration of Glasgow Rangers Football Club.
Office managing partner in Manchester, Rod Waldie said: “We are delighted to welcome Richard and the team to the firm. They will add weight to our corporate Recovery team in Manchester which has strength and versatility in a range of areas specifically in the retail, pensions, automotive, technology, manufacturing and professional services sectors.”
Mr Healey added: “This is a great opportunity to add to the specialisms of Gateley’s corporate recovery team, which is widely regarded as one of the best in the North West.”

KUITS, the Manchester law firm has announced three new hires, with
solicitors Craig Oldale and James Skivington joining the employment and corporate departments respectively while Kathryn Parrish, who trained at the firm, has qualified into the commercial litigation and recoveries team.
In the last 18 months Kuits headcount has grown from 124 to 145. Managing partner Steve Eccleston said: ““It is part of our continued strategy to broaden and strengthen the quality of service we provide to clients.
“We have seen growth in our employment, employment and litigation teams and are delighted to welcome Craig, James and Kathryn to the firm to help bolster these areas.”

NICHE Cheshire family law firm James Maguire & Co has appointed Henry Venables and Lisa Brown as associates.
The pair, who have joined from DWF, are reunited at the Wilmslow firm with founder and principal James Maguire, a former partner at DWF.
The duo are known for their work and expertise in matrimonial finance and also cases involving children.

CHESTER C&C Catering Equipment has expanded its sales team with the appointment of Mark Hother.
Mr Hother, who worked for the specialist contractor in the 1990s, will focus on winning new business in Wales.
Managing director Peter Kitchin says, “We already have a fantastic sales team and Mark will only help to boost it further. He’s hardworking and passionate about what we do. It’s great to have him back with us.”
